Thanks, dude. Means a lot. Don't want to take sides here because I appreciate everyone's perspective, but I'm glad you like it. So to answer yours questions... That is me singing and playing guitars/bass. I had a few friends contribute as well (drums, piano, organ, backup vox). All of the recording was done in my bedroom with blankets hung on the walls. I mixed it and sent it to a mastering engineer in Arizona.
